Nail Wrap review- Nail Art Warehouse

I recently brought same nail wraps off Groupon 12 designs for £15, which is quite a bargain. The brand I normal Trendy Nail Warps cost £5 each.
The delivery took 10 days which was quite a while, but I didn't mind as they were cheap.

Just some of the designs I bought

I tried them out first on my toes. They wrap its self feels like a sticker not like the other ones I have used which are foils. 
The wraps were too small for my toes, width wise. They were hard to smooth off the edges and I ended up with some bubbles. I followed all the instructions that came with them. The ones on my toes have lasted a week and half so far.

Next I tried them out on my finger nails hoping they would be a better fit. I had to cut these down allot to fit my nails but that was fine. The problem which really got to me was how ever hard I tried I got bubbles in the wrap and couldn't smooth it out. And the free edge was also very hard to file down smooth. 
So this wraps are a bit of a let down, great designs though. Have a look at my photos and see what you think.

Sunday Shopping trip Make up

Watched a really interesting programme on NHK yesterday called Kawaii International that inspired me to try playing with bottom eye lashes. So this looking is inspired by Shibuya fashion.



I've still got a long way to go, to getting the eye lashes to look more Gyaru .
These are the products I used for my base. I've only just started using the Illamasque concealer, it has a really soft texture and its actually light enough for me skin.


Illamasque cream blusher to highlght cheeks and Mac mineral blusher under cheekbones. I used a small amount of bronzer to try and contour my nose.  I wasn't impressed with the N07 bronzer, it just makes my skin look dirty. I must try and find a good bronzer for light skin.

Trusted Shu Umera lash curlers and Max Factor False Lash Effect mascara. I used Mac pigment in frost as a shimmery base all over the eye lid. I then used the light pink from my Stila pallet and the burgundy in the crease line. I used Bobbi Brow gel liner in on top lashes and Urban Decay pencil on lower lashes.

Bottom eye lashes are number 43 from Eylure, I had to cut these down quite a bit. Top lashes were from Bodyline in Japan. I used the Eylure lash glue this time. It stuck well but didn't stay on in the wind when I went shopping, so I won't be using it again.
